Output 31140d570a04e68c5e8ecfbd21dceb3aa008f37c33f6d4bf32abb00a66f5f984:30

value
3149537
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8ee08ebec54afeed5ba8c6c6b5d555edd727db3e OP_EQUALVERIFY OP_CHECKSIG
address
1E2TxmyQkonvxAZzXAcPu542QYcNciUEy4
transaction
31140d570a04e68c5e8ecfbd21dceb3aa008f37c33f6d4bf32abb00a66f5f984
confirmations
134538
spent
true